Blocked Gutters Can Cause Problems With Your Foundation
No matter where you live having blocked gutters can create a number of serious problems with your property. Blocked gutters can lead to an overflow near your properties foundation, which will then attract harmful insects such as subterranean termites. In these conditions, moisture pests like silverfish, earwigs , cockroaches, centipedes, and millipedes can thrive.
Clogged gutters can also provide a breeding area for insects carrying diseases such as mosquitoes. For mosquito eggs to develop and mature they need standing water. A mosquito infestation can quickly spread and become a serious problem.
Rodents and insects can also make use of clogged gutters to shelter their nests. Squirrels and rats like living in gutters as well if they can reach them easily from tree branches. Clogged gutters provide the squirrels and rats with a safe place to live during winter. These areas are safe for them to breed as they can’t easily be detected by people.
Clogged gutters are also loved by bees, wasps (hornets), and other stinging insects. They use them to build their hives and to be able to hunt other water-dwelling bugs. A beehive could weigh down your gutters enough so that bees, wasps and hornets could penetrate your roof and get into your property. Not only can bees sting, but they also can cause severe structural damage to your property. This could lead to flooding in your home, which could cause a lot of damage to your belongings and result in mold and mildew growing.
These pests can be removed by professional gutter cleaners.
Clogged gutters can also lead to stagnant water accumulation. One inch of rain is roughly 1,500 gallons of water.
Clean gutters will make your home less vulnerable to rodents and other pests.
Regular Gutter Cleaning Is Vital
Rain gutters are essential to protect your home from water runoff and prevent foundation and roof damage. It is not just essential to maintain curb appeal but also a requirement for the upkeep of your property. This is more important than lawn trimming or tree trimming because blocked gutters can cause major damage to your roof and property.
If your gutters aren’t cleaned regularly, leaves, branches, trees saplings, or other debris can build up and block the flow of water. If your gutters are blocked and rainwater is not flowing properly to your drain then water can build up on your roof and can also cause it to egress to your foundation. This can cause irreparable damage and costly repairs. In winter ice dams can also be caused by blocked gutters.
Regular gutter cleaning will prevent the nesting of insects and ice dams during winter. This can help protect your foundation from water damage by ensuring that rain water drains away from your house and into the drains. You will also avoid ugly rainwater spots on the sides of your home.

How Often Do I Need to Clean My Gutters?
Maintaining your gutters, downpipes and drains and keeping them free of debris and obstructions will help them work efficiently and keep any rainwater away from your home, protecting your home from serious damage.
Your gutters should be cleaned at the very least once a year. If you have large trees or if it’s a severe storm, you need to clean them more frequently. Regular gutter cleaning is essential otherwise the costs of repairs will far outweigh the cost of gutter cleaning.

What Is The Cost Of Gutter Cleaning Services In Mill Creek
The cost to clean your gutters varies widely. Gutter cleaning costs are affected by many factors, including the size and accessibility of your gutters. The height of your roof will determine how much you pay. Dependent on the size of your gutters and their complexity, gutter cleaning professionals might need special safety ladders. Accessing gutters might be difficult on uneven or sloping terrain. You may also need special equipment for steep roof pitches.
They might suggest other services, including installing gutter guards, which prevent large debris like leaves and hair from entering the gutter system, as well as working on gutter repairs, fasteners tightening, and sealing outlets or end caps. These additional services may increase the cost for gutter cleaning.
A gutter cleaning company is well worth the investment. It can prevent structural problems such as leaky roofing, which can run up to $5,000 to $40,000 to fix. A gutter cleaning will prevent the growth and development of harmful mold and mildew which can lead to respiratory difficulties. Water damage repair and mold removal can be costly if they are not addressed quickly. Gutter cleaning is vital to the health of your home.

Gutter Cleaning FAQs
Is it worth it to clean your own gutters?
Some homeowners bust out the ladder and clean their own gutters, but when you consider the time, risks and quality of a DIY job, it's clear that hiring a professional gutter cleaning service is almost always worth the money.
How often should I clean my gutters?
Speaking in general terms, you should make a point of cleaning your gutters at least twice a year. Depending on what sort of foliage you have near your home (such as pine trees), you may want to clean once every three months.
What time of year is best for gutter cleaning?
Most experts agree the best time of year to clean your gutters is in the spring and fall. An early spring cleaning will help clear out all the leaves and debris from your gutters and ensure rainfall can flow freely into the spouts.
How long does it take to clean gutters?
An average-size home about 2,000 square feet on a roof maintenance program where gutters are cleaned every year should take about 30 to 45 minutes, depending on how dirty they are. Gutters that haven't been maintained can take up to an hour or an hour and a half.
How much does it cost to clean gutters near me?
For most homeowners, gutter cleaning costs $0.80 per linear foot of gutter. For the average two-story home, the national average cost is $160, assuming you have 200 feet of gutters. Gutter cleaning for single-story homes costs around $0.40 per linear foot.
